Euglossa villosa is a species of orchid bee in the genus Euglossa. It has been found in Mexico, Guatemala, Nicaragua, Costa Rica, and Panama.[1]
Description
It is a metallic green with a bronzy iridescence on the mesoscutum, metatibia, and metasoma.[2]
